On 17/10/13 15:37, Adrián Roselló Rey wrote:
Hi all!

I have an OSGI application, which publish some services through a
RESTful WS using CXF DOSGI, and using Jetty as the Web server. The
current versions we are using are:

CXF: 2.7.4
DOSGI: 1.5.0
Jetty: 7.5.4

To explain our problem I will take two services as example. Service "A"
is successfully published and its interface is exported by DOSGI without
problem. We can remotely access to it by the
URLhttp://myserver/myapp/serviceA/ and we do publish it via BluePrint.

https://github.com/dana-i2cat/opennaas/blob/master/core/resources/src/main/resources/OSGI-INF/blueprint/core.xml#L16

Service "B" is successfully published as an OSGI service, but we can not
access to the URL http://myserver/myapp/serviceB. We publish it manually
from code.

https://github.com/dana-i2cat/opennaas/blob/master/core/security/src/main/java/org/opennaas/core/security/acl/ACLManager.java#L174

The strange thing is that, after rebooting our platform, sometimes both
services are published, but sometimes only one of them.

Does anyone have any idea on what could be happening? We changed CXF
version to 2.7.6, but we noticed the same behaviour. I attached logs of
both services booting process, but they look very similar.
